Charles T. Dazey(1855-1938)

  • Writer
  • Editor
IMDbProStarmeterSee rank
Charles T. Dazey was born on 13 August 1855 in Lima, Illinois, USA. He was a writer and editor, known for Un derby sensationnel (1922), Une aventure à New-York (1916) and The Midnight Trail (1918). He was married to Lucy Harding. He died on 9 February 1938 in Quincy, Illinois, USA.
